## Changelog — Gridwharf 4.2.0

Changed defaults for spreadsheet export. Previously, Gridwharf buffered the entire workbook in memory before streaming, which caused OOM kills on tenants exporting more than ~200k rows. Exports now use a row-chunked writer with a bounded buffer, and the default chunk size has been lowered accordingly. Maintainers should note that exports are slightly slower but memory usage is now flat regardless of sheet size. Overrides still work via the usual env mechanism. The new shipped defaults are as follows.

settings of yahaf-tahop:
jorox:
  pin: 5851
  tenant: noveth
  seal: seal_7ddb5c42
  metrics_host: metrics.jorox.ordinnet.example
  standby_team: wenax
  escalation: oliath-feneth
  nonce: 552548

Handover: PickWise optimizer

Welcome to the team. PickWise generates optimized pick lists for the Bramleigh warehouse each morning at 04:00. It reads slotting data, solves routes, and publishes to the floor tablets. Watch the solver timeout metric — anything over 90 seconds means stale slotting data. Config and tuning parameters are stored in an encrypted bundle; you will need to unlock it during onboarding. The bundle's recovery passphrase appears below.

unlock words, hafop-tahog: drumir-druiel-kasox-wenax-tamys-frair

Capacity note for the Bramblewick export retry queue. Failed exports are requeued with exponential backoff, and the queue depth is our main capacity signal: sustained depth above the high-water mark means downstream Pellis storage is saturated, not that we need more workers. As the new contractor, please don't raise worker counts without checking storage latency first — it usually makes things worse. Retry timing, backoff caps, and the high-water threshold are all driven by the constants shown below.

limits module of yagef-bajog:
TIERS = {
    "druael": 370,
    "tamix": 286,
    "pelius": 541,
    "pelael": 78,
    "pelox": 47,
    "ralath": 533,
    "drumir": 801,
}